What are the must-see historical places and other sights to visit in Port Macquarie?
Port Macquarie is notable for landmarks like Tacking Point Lighthouse, Lake Innes Ruins and Douglas Vale Historic Homestead & Vineyard. Cultural venues include Mid North Coast Maritime Museum Pilot Boat Shed, Glasshouse Cultural Centre and Port Macquarie Museum. A couple of additional sights to add to your itinerary are Town Beach and Flynns Beach.
What is a historic hotel like in Port Macquarie?
Guests who choose a historic hotel can stay in a place that has an officially recognised historic designation. A palace, castle, grand home or even an old police station, pub, lodge or skyscraper can be identified as a historic hotel as long as it has special significance. Traditional architecture and period features are typically preserved in the guestrooms or communal spaces of these historic hotels in Port Macquarie, giving a real sense of character.
What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
“Heritage hotel” is more common in Asia and Europe, wheareas the term “historic hotel” is more commonly used in the U.S. though overall the terms are quite similar. The physical building and architecture of historic hotels are generally what’s most important. For a heritage hotel, mainly, it’s cultural value as well as how it shaped the community.
